Marzae Origine offers a blend of Arandell, Blaufränkish, and Marquette grapes. While specific details about appellation are unknown at this time, each variety brings its unique character to the mix. The Marquette grape, known for its bright, spicy qualities with cherry and berry fruit, plays a central role in this wine's profile. Expect a wine that showcases the versatility of cold-hardy grapes like Marquette, suitable for a range of dishes from grilled sausages to tomato-based pasta dishes.
